BRUTTIUM, Kroton. Circa 480-430 BC. AR Nomos (23mm, 6.92 g, 3h). Tripod, legs terminating in lion's feet / Incuse eagle flying right. Gorini 27; HN Italy 2108; SNG ANS 287. VF, toned, some find patina, minor roughness.
From the Hanbery Collection, purchased from Frank Kovacs, with his old inventory ticket.
